Historical Background:

As part of the United States Mint's initiative to celebrate the Louisiana Purchase, the 2004 Jefferson Nickel was designed to commemorate the 200th anniversary of this significant event. The Louisiana Purchase, completed in 1803, doubled the size of the United States and paved the way for westward expansion. The coin serves as a tangible reminder of this historic transaction between the United States and France.

Technical Specifications:

  • Denomination: 5 Cents
  • Composition: Copper-nickel
  • Diameter: 21.21 mm
  • Weight: 5 grams
  • Edge: Plain
  • Mint: United States Mint
